Position Overview: Finance Analyst
Location: Immingham
Function: Support various financial activities across Volumetric Accounting, Transactional Accounting, and UK-based reporting.
Core Responsibilities
- Multi-Disciplinary Support: Provide flexible assistance across three main pillars: Volumetric Accounting, Transactional Accounting, and Financial Reporting as business needs dictate.
- Reconciliations: Manage and resolve discrepancies in customer and vendor accounts, as well as physical stock locations across the UK.
- General Ledger: Execute balance sheet reconciliations for key general ledger accounts.
- Data Management: Handle journal preparation, entry, and month-end reporting cycles.
- Collaboration: Act as a liaison with corporate headquarters on ad hoc queries and support internal projects as required.
Critical Skills & Experience
- Background: Proven experience in a varied accounting or analytical role.
- Systems: High level of IT literacy; SAP experience is highly preferred.
